- The Envirocool system is an
evaporative cooling air inlet device used in
conjunction with the Quiet Cool whole house fans
(sold separately) that allows you to cool your home
far more efficiently and effectively than a
conventional air conditioner or by using our whole
house fans alone

|
How does it work? |
| |
The Envirocool unit consists of
eight
square feet of a patented high tech 8 inch thick cellulose
media over which a small water pump circulates water
that trickles down through the media and into a drain
pan. Turning on your Quiet Cool fans installed in the attic
creates a negative pressure (vacuum) that draws
outside air into the home through the openings in the
media. As the outside air passes through the media, it
is cooled by evaporation, as much as 35 degrees F.
This cooled air is drawn all the way through the home
and up into the Quiet Cool fans that discharge it into
the attic. This cooled air is then forced out of the
attic vents by pressure provided by the Quiet Cool
fans.
|
|
|
Will it work
without the Quiet Cool fans? |
| |
The Quiet Cool fans are necessary
to make it work. There is no fan or blower motor in
the Envirocool. The fact that the air is sucked all the
way through the house and up into the attic and out
the attic vents by the Quiet Cool fans is what makes
this operate so much more effectively than a
conventional evaporative cooler.

How much does it
cool? |
| |
The amount of cooling is dependent
on the relative humidity. The temperature of the
cooled air can be calculated knowing the outside air
temperature and the outside wet bulb temperature. In
very dry desert climates, it can cool 110 deg. F
outside air down to about 72 degrees. In moderate
humidity climates such as inland areas of Southern
California , 100 deg. F outside air can normally be
cooled to 70 to 72 degrees F. In very high humidity
areas, outside air can still be cooled 10 to 20
degrees.
|
|
|
Will it work in my
climate? |
| |
Yes, it will work in almost all
climates. It is most effective in hot dry desert
climates, but even in humid climates, it will still
cool your home 10 to 20 degrees F. cooler than the
outside temperature.
|
|
|
How much
electricity does it use? |
| |
There is only one moving part in
the Envirocool, which is the water pump that only uses
25 Watts of power.
|
|
|
How much water
does it use? |
| |
In a hot dry desert climate it
uses the most water - about 3 gallons per hour. In a
full days use, that's about as much as one person
taking a shower, or a garden hose being turned on for
3 minutes.

What about
bringing dirty, dusty outside air into the house?
|
| |
In almost all locations, the outside air is actually
cleaner than inside air, but whatever dust and dirt is
in the outside air is washed by the water flowing down
through the media. The dirt is deposited into the
water pan which is automatically drained out every
evening when the Envirocool turns itself off.
